Why Metal Roofing Stands Out
Standard asphalt roof shingles have lengthy controlled the roofing market, however metal roofing is getting appeal completely reason. Unlike traditional materials, metal roofing systems provide a blend of strength, longevity, and style that's tough to defeat. Made from products like steel, aluminum, or copper, metal roofing can stand up to rough climate-- think heavy rain, high winds, and even hail-- better than numerous options.
One of the greatest advantages of metal roofing is its life-span. While asphalt tiles could require roof replacement every 15-20 years, a well-installed steel roofing can last 40-70 years with marginal maintenance. That longevity converts into fewer roof repair calls with time, making it an economical option in the long run. And also, metal reflects sunshine instead of absorbing it, which can lower cooling down costs in warmer environments-- a bonus offer for energy-conscious house owners.
Beyond usefulness, metal roofing adds a modern-day aesthetic to any property. Readily available in sleek panels, tiles, or even designs imitating typical ceramic tiles, it's versatile enough for homes, barns, or business buildings. When to Call a Roofer Near Me for Roof Repair
No roofing lasts forever without some TLC, and even metal roofing can require attention once in a while. Knowing when to arrange roof repair can protect against small issues from becoming pricey headaches. Right here are some indicators it's time to search for a roofer near me:
Leaks or Water Stains: If you identify wet spots on your ceiling or walls, your roof covering might have a breach. Metal roofings are much less prone to leaks than roof shingles, however joints or bolts can loosen in time.
Dents or Damage: Hail, dropping branches, or hefty particles can damage metal roofing. While it's harder than asphalt, visible damage warrants a roof repair check to guarantee stability.
Corrosion or Corrosion: High-quality metal roofing features safety coatings, but older roofing systems or those in damp areas may reveal corrosion. A roofer near me can examine whether place fixings or a complete roof replacement makes good sense.
Missing Out On Pieces: Strong winds can raise panels or remove blinking. Any kind of voids ask for prompt roof repair to stay clear of water seepage.
Normal examinations-- specifically after extreme climate-- can capture these issues early. A trusted roofer near me will climb up, evaluate the damage, and advise the most effective solution, whether it's a fast patch or a much more involved roof replacement.
Roof Replacement: Is It Time?
Sometimes, roof repair isn't sufficient, and a complete roof replacement ends up being the smarter move. But how do you recognize when to take that action? For metal roofing and other materials alike, age is a large variable. If your present roofing system is nearing completion of its anticipated life-- 20 years for asphalt, 50+ for steel-- it's worth intending in advance. Regular leaks, widespread damage, or rising power costs from inadequate insulation are likewise red flags.
Choosing metal roofing for a roof replacement offers long-term advantages, yet it's not a one-size-fits-all option. Metal excels in resilience and weather resistance, yet it's costlier upfront than asphalt. If you reside in an area prone to wildfires, hefty snow, or cyclones, the investment frequently pays off-- some steel roofings even feature fireproof scores or warranties versus extreme problems.
When thinking about roof replacement, timing matters also. Springtime and fall are excellent periods for roofing work, staying clear of the warm of summer and the ice of wintertime. The Cost of Roofing Projects
Budgeting for metal roofing, roof repair, or roof replacement relies on numerous aspects: the size of your roofing system, the materials picked, and neighborhood labor rates. A basic roof repair might set you back $200-$ 1,000, depending upon the damage. For roof replacement, asphalt shingles balance $5,000-$ 10,000 for a normal home, while metal roofing can range from $10,000-$ 20,000 or even more, mirroring its superior quality and long life.
While metal roofing has a higher upfront price, its low maintenance and power cost savings often stabilize things out. Many service providers use financing, and some metal roofing items get approved for tax obligation debts or insurance coverage discounts as a result of their sturdiness.
